#117 – There will be a time in the life of the college-bound high school student when making a list of colleges and universities will be a priority. The schools in the list will be the ones to which he or she will be sending an application for admission. On this episode, we begin a series of episodes that explores the different types of colleges and universities available to students. Not all colleges are the same. We begin by uncovering the differences between each different type and give you an understanding of what students in those institutions may experience. In truth, there is no institution that is perfect for every student. While some institutions offer a great fit to some students, for other students with different needs and wants, those same institutions may not be ideal. This is an important point to consider because, for some students, attending an institution that is not ideal may prove to be an obstacle to learning. After listening to this episode, you will be able to discern the differences between the different schools, and begin to identify the types of schools that offer you or your kid a better fit.
